At the heart of mobile app development lies an ambitious idea, demanding attention to every detail for its success. Given mobile phones are globally used, development must be both systematic and multifaceted - Here are six factors essential for sustainable app development:

Methodology: Methodologies in sustainable mobile app development refer to frameworks used by development teams to organize, plan and control the creation process for an information system. Such methodologies often divide development into stages for enhanced planning and management capabilities - examples being waterfall, prototyping agile or Scrum, with its adaptable real-time communication features.

Agile Development Methodology: Agile software development is the cornerstone of many software projects ranging from mobile apps to enterprise solutions. By adopting short timeboxes or "iterations," agile methods aim to reduce risks while offering incremental functionality. Their popularity stems from real-time communication, face-to-face interactions, continuous working software, and iterative development with a constant reassessment of project priorities that define agile approaches.

User Experience Design (UXD): It is essential in improving accessibility, usability and user satisfaction. Visual design, information architecture structuring the organization and labelling all contribute to an optimal UX. Involving select users when testing an MVP will facilitate iterative improvements based on feedback; following platform-specific UI guidelines while constantly refining design via feedback will lead to maximum end-user satisfaction.

Functional Testing: Functional testing is a form of black-box testing used to assess mobile app functionality against predefined test cases. Unlike system testing, functional testing verifies whether programs align with design documents while verifying an app's functionality. Functional testing should not be seen as the final stage in its own right; instead, it ensures its intended functionality.

API Management: API management is key in opening APIs up to external partners and internal developers, unlocking data's full potential while helping businesses expand operations digitally. Key competencies of API management include developer engagement, analytics, security and protection to form an efficient API program.

Connectivity, Promotion and Marketing: Users are at the core of any successful business, making customer engagement crucial. Leverage mobile websites to market and promote your app by leveraging existing traffic to attract early adopters; blogs and emails may help raise download numbers significantly; prioritizing SEO while engaging relevant social media communities will further extend its reach.
